Core Information Architecture

Information architecture determines how quickly a user can understand what the event is and why they should attend. Your page should be organized into a logical hierarchy that guides the user from awareness to action. Start with a clear headline that names your event, followed by a succinct "Why" statement. Avoid clutter; if a piece of information does not assist in the decision to purchase a ticket, it should be moved to a secondary section or eliminated.

Key Information Components

  • Event Date and Time: Display this prominently in local formats. For multi-day events, include a clear schedule or agenda block.
  • Venue Details: Use accurate location names and, where possible, integrate clear directions. If the event is virtual, explain the digital access method.
  • Ticket Tiers: Clearly distinguish between Early Bird, Regular, and VIP tickets. Use clear pricing and bulleted lists to show exactly what is included in each tier.
  • Visual Trust Signals: Include high-quality imagery from previous iterations of your event or branded promotional material that aligns with your campaign identity.

Optimizing the Checkout Experience

The checkout process is the most critical stage of your conversion funnel. If a user is ready to buy but finds the interface clunky or slow, you lose the sale. Strategies for a Frictionless Checkout

  1. Mobile-First Design: Ensure your registration forms are easy to tap and read on small screens. Avoid requiring too much personal information at the initial stage.

Enhancing Trust and Accessibility

Trust signals help alleviate anxiety regarding the purchase of an online ticket. Including a clear FAQ section on your landing page addresses potential hesitations before they become barriers to conversion. Furthermore, inclusivity is not just an ethical requirement; it is a business strategy. Ensure your event page content is readable by using high-contrast text and clear typography, making it accessible to as many potential participants as possible.

The Essential FAQ Checklist

Ensure your page answers these fundamental questions to keep attendees informed:

  • What is the refund policy?
  • Is parking or transport provided?
  • Can tickets be transferred to another person?
  • What identification do I need to bring for QR verification at the gate?

By answering these in a structured FAQ section at the bottom of your event page, you reduce the number of support inquiries and reassure attendees that your event is legitimate and well-managed.
